- #ifndef LS_SIZE
- #define LS_SIZE 0x40000 /* 256K (in bytes) */
- #endif
- typedef unsigned int u32;
- typedef unsigned long long u64;
- #include <spu_intrinsics.h>
- #include <asm/spu_csa.h>
- #include "spu_utils.h"
- static inline void save_event_mask(void)
- {
- unsigned int offset;
- /* Save, Step 2:
- * Read the SPU_RdEventMsk channel and save to the LSCSA.
- */
- offset = LSCSA_QW_OFFSET(event_mask);
- regs_spill[offset].slot[0] = spu_readch(SPU_RdEventMask);
- }
- static inline void save_tag_mask(void)
- {
- unsigned int offset;
- /* Save, Step 3:
- * Read the SPU_RdTagMsk channel and save to the LSCSA.
- */
- offset = LSCSA_QW_OFFSET(tag_mask);
- regs_spill[offset].slot[0] = spu_readch(MFC_RdTagMask);
- }
- static inline void save_upper_240kb(addr64 lscsa_ea)
- {
- unsigned int ls = 16384;
- unsigned int list = (unsigned int)&dma_list[0];
- unsigned int size = sizeof(dma_list);
- unsigned int tag_id = 0;
- unsigned int cmd = 0x24; /* PUTL */
- /* Save, Step 7:
- * Enqueue the PUTL command (tag 0) to the MFC SPU command
- * queue to transfer the remaining 240 kb of LS to CSA.
- */
- spu_writech(MFC_LSA, ls);
- spu_writech(MFC_EAH, lscsa_ea.ui[0]);
- spu_writech(MFC_EAL, list);
- spu_writech(MFC_Size, size);
- spu_writech(MFC_TagID, tag_id);
- spu_writech(MFC_Cmd, cmd);
- }
- static inline void save_fpcr(void)
- {
- // vector unsigned int fpcr;
- unsigned int offset;
- /* Save, Step 9:
- * Issue the floating-point status and control register
- * read instruction, and save to the LSCSA.
- */
- offset = LSCSA_QW_OFFSET(fpcr);
- regs_spill[offset].v = spu_mffpscr();
- }
- static inline void save_decr(void)
- {
- unsigned int offset;
- /* Save, Step 10:
- * Read and save the SPU_RdDec channel data to
- * the LSCSA.
- */
- offset = LSCSA_QW_OFFSET(decr);
- regs_spill[offset].slot[0] = spu_readch(SPU_RdDec);
- }
- static inline void save_srr0(void)
- {
- unsigned int offset;
- /* Save, Step 11:
- * Read and save the SPU_WSRR0 channel data to
- * the LSCSA.
- */
- offset = LSCSA_QW_OFFSET(srr0);
- regs_spill[offset].slot[0] = spu_readch(SPU_RdSRR0);
- }
- static inline void spill_regs_to_mem(addr64 lscsa_ea)
- {
- unsigned int ls = (unsigned int)®s_spill[0];
- unsigned int size = sizeof(regs_spill);
- unsigned int tag_id = 0;
- unsigned int cmd = 0x20; /* PUT */
- /* Save, Step 13:
- * Enqueue a PUT command (tag 0) to send the LSCSA
- * to the CSA.
- */
- spu_writech(MFC_LSA, ls);
- spu_writech(MFC_EAH, lscsa_ea.ui[0]);
- spu_writech(MFC_EAL, lscsa_ea.ui[1]);
- spu_writech(MFC_Size, size);
- spu_writech(MFC_TagID, tag_id);
- spu_writech(MFC_Cmd, cmd);
- }
- static inline void enqueue_sync(addr64 lscsa_ea)
- {
- unsigned int tag_id = 0;
- unsigned int cmd = 0xCC;
- /* Save, Step 14:
- * Enqueue an MFC_SYNC command (tag 0).
- */
- spu_writech(MFC_TagID, tag_id);
- spu_writech(MFC_Cmd, cmd);
- }
- static inline void save_complete(void)
- {
- /* Save, Step 18:
- * Issue a stop-and-signal instruction indicating
- * "save complete". Note: This function will not
- * return!!
- */
- spu_stop(SPU_SAVE_COMPLETE);
- }
- /**
- * main - entry point for SPU-side context save.
- *
- * This code deviates from the documented sequence as follows:
- *
- * 1. The EA for LSCSA is passed from PPE in the
- * signal notification channels.
- * 2. All 128 registers are saved by crt0.o.
- */
- int main()
- {
- addr64 lscsa_ea;
- lscsa_ea.ui[0] = spu_readch(SPU_RdSigNotify1);
- lscsa_ea.ui[1] = spu_readch(SPU_RdSigNotify2);
- /* Step 1: done by exit(). */
- save_event_mask(); /* Step 2. */
- save_tag_mask(); /* Step 3. */
- set_event_mask(); /* Step 4. */
- set_tag_mask(); /* Step 5. */
- build_dma_list(lscsa_ea); /* Step 6. */
- save_upper_240kb(lscsa_ea); /* Step 7. */
- /* Step 8: done by exit(). */
- save_fpcr(); /* Step 9. */
- save_decr(); /* Step 10. */
- save_srr0(); /* Step 11. */
- enqueue_putllc(lscsa_ea); /* Step 12. */
- spill_regs_to_mem(lscsa_ea); /* Step 13. */
- enqueue_sync(lscsa_ea); /* Step 14. */
- set_tag_update(); /* Step 15. */
- read_tag_status(); /* Step 16. */
- read_llar_status(); /* Step 17. */
- save_complete(); /* Step 18. */
- return 0;
- }
